That&#8217;s why each of the <strong>Cusco streets<\/strong> has its own charm, and walking through them is an essential part of the experience in this city.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"The_5_Cusco_streets_you_cant_miss\"><\/span>The 5 Cusco streets you can\u2019t miss<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Hatun_Rumiyoc_Street_and_the_12-angle_stone\"><\/span>Hatun Rumiyoc Street and the 12-angle stone<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">It\u2019s impossible to talk about the Cusco streets without mentioning this one. In the heart of the historic center, <strong>Hatun Rumiyoc<\/strong> houses one of the most famous pieces of Inca heritage: <strong>the stone of the 12 angles<\/strong>. Its precision continues to amaze everyone.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The street is narrow and cobbled, connecting you to centuries of history in just a few meters. This street is a must-visit for photos, but also to understand why the city of Cusco is unique.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img fetchpriority=\"high\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"935\" height=\"490\" src=\"https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-hatun-rumiyoc-12-angles.webp\" alt=\"Cusco Hatun Rumiyoc Street, 12-angle stone\" class=\"wp-image-17170\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-hatun-rumiyoc-12-angles.webp 935w, https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-hatun-rumiyoc-12-angles-768x402.webp 768w, https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-hatun-rumiyoc-12-angles-900x472.webp 900w, https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-hatun-rumiyoc-12-angles-600x314.webp 600w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 935px) 100vw, 935px\" \/><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Loreto_Street_the_balance_between_Inca_walls_and_living_culture\"><\/span>Loreto Street: the balance between Inca walls and living culture<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Located just a few steps from the Plaza de Armas, this street is a great example of how the Inca past and the colonial era coexist in the same place. On one side, you&#8217;ll see original Inca walls, perfectly preserved, and on the other, buildings constructed during the colonial period.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Here, you can also see the remnants of <strong>the ancient Palace of Amaru Cancha<\/strong>, the residence of the Inca Huayna C\u00e1pac. It&#8217;s an ideal street for a peaceful walk, where you can observe details that tell centuries of history.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img decoding=\"async\" width=\"935\" height=\"490\" src=\"https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-loreto-middle-street.webp\" alt=\"Cusco Streets - Loreto Street, Middle Street to Plaza de Armas\" class=\"wp-image-17171\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-loreto-middle-street.webp 935w, https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-loreto-middle-street-768x402.webp 768w, https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-loreto-middle-street-900x472.webp 900w, https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-loreto-middle-street-600x314.webp 600w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 935px) 100vw, 935px\" \/><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Siete_Borreguitos_Street_the_most_Instagrammable_of_Cusco\"><\/span>Siete Borreguitos Street: the most Instagrammable of Cusco<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">It\u2019s one of the most photogenic Cusco streets in the city. It\u2019s a challenge that turns into a reward from the very first glimpse.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"935\" height=\"490\" src=\"https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-resbalosa.webp\" alt=\"Cusco Streets - Resbalosa street towards San Cristobal Square\" class=\"wp-image-17172\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-resbalosa.webp 935w, https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-resbalosa-768x402.webp 768w, https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-resbalosa-900x472.webp 900w, https:\/\/www.perugrandtravel.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/cusco-streets-resbalosa-600x314.webp 600w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 935px) 100vw, 935px\" \/><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-table\"><table class=\"has-fixed-layout\"><thead><tr><td><strong>Cusco Street<\/strong><\/td><td><strong>Main Highlight<\/strong><\/td><td><strong>Experience Style<\/strong><\/td><\/tr><\/thead><tbody><tr><td><strong>Hatun Rumiyoc<\/strong><\/td><td>Stone of the 12 Angles<\/td><td>Historic and Iconic<\/td><\/tr><tr><td><strong>Loreto<\/strong><\/td><td>Royal Inca Walls<\/td><td>Architecture and Culture<\/td><\/tr><tr><td><strong>Siete Borreguitos<\/strong><\/td><td>Flowery Staircases<\/td><td>Photography and Charm<\/td><\/tr><tr><td><strong>San Blas<\/strong><\/td><td>Studios and Caf\u00e9s<\/td><td>Bohemia and Art<\/td><\/tr><tr><td><strong>Resbalosa<\/strong><\/td><td>San Crist\u00f3bal Viewpoint<\/td><td>Adventure and Panoramic View<\/td><\/tr><\/tbody><\/table><figcaption class=\"wp-element-caption\">Comparison Chart: The Ideal Cusco Street for You<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"How_to_create_a_walking_route_through_the_most_beautiful_Cusco_streets\"><\/span>How to create a walking route through the most beautiful Cusco streets<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Suggested_half-day_route_for_travelers_with_limited_time\"><\/span>Suggested half-day route for travelers with limited time<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">If you have little time but don\u2019t want to miss the best of the <strong>Cusco streets<\/strong>, this route is perfect for you. It combines history, art, incredible views, and perfect photo opportunities: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ol class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Start by entering the Plaza de Armas through Calle Loreto<\/strong>, where you&#8217;ll see original Inca walls on either side.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Then, turn right to walk along the famous <strong>Hatun Rumiyoc street<\/strong> and stop in front of the <strong>stone of the 12 angles.<\/strong><\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>From there, head up the colorful <strong>Siete Borreguitos<\/strong> <strong>street<\/strong>, an ideal spot for unique photos.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Continue your journey to <strong>the San Blas neighborhood<\/strong>, known for its art, artisan workshops, and relaxed atmosphere.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Head back down to <strong>Plaza de Armas<\/strong> and get ready for the final stretch.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Climb up <strong>Resbalosa street<\/strong>, which will take you straight to the <strong>San Crist\u00f3bal viewpoint,<\/strong> where you&#8217;ll have one of the best panoramic views of the city.<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Can_I_visit_the_Cusco_streets_alone\"><\/span>Can I visit the Cusco streets alone?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Yes, you can explore the Cusco streets with no problem, whether alone or with others<\/strong>. What is the main and most famous street in Cusco?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<div class=\"rank-math-answer \">\n\n<p>The main artery connecting the historic center to the modern part of the city is Avenida El Sol. However, if we are talking about historical prestige\u2014and the most photographed street in Cusco\u2014that title belongs to Hatun Rumiyoc, the celebrated stone passageway that houses the famous 12-Angled Stone.<\/p>\n\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div id=\"faq-question-1776722405047\" class=\"rank-math-list-item\">\n<h3 class=\"rank-math-question \"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"2_Where_is_Cusco_located_and_how_does_it_differ_from_Machu_Picchu\"><\/span>2. Where is Cusco located, and how does it differ from Machu Picchu?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<div class=\"rank-math-answer \">\n\n<p>This is a classic question! Cusco is the base city\u2014the majestic capital of the ancient Inca Empire\u2014located in the Andes at an altitude of approximately 3,400 meters. The citadel of Machu Picchu, on the other hand, is an isolated sanctuary situated in the cloud forest (high jungle), located about a 4-hour journey from Cusco (combining ground transport and a luxury train).<\/p>\n\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div id=\"faq-question-1776722418536\" class=\"rank-math-list-item\">\n<h3 class=\"rank-math-question \"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"3_Which_neighborhood_is_the_best_place_to_stay_for_exploring_the_city_on_foot\"><\/span>3.
